What's The Definition Of Title?
title
countable noun: The title of a book, play, film, or piece of music is its name. verb: When a writer, composer, or artist titles a work, they give it a title. title in American English the name of a book, chapter, poem, essay, picture, statue, piece of music, play, film, etc. adjective: of or pertaining to a title noun: the distinguishing name of a book, poem, picture, piece of music, or the like transitive verb: to furnish with a title; designate by an appellation; entitle title in British English noun: the distinctive name of a work of art, musical, or literary composition, etc verb: to give a title to title in Finance noun: Title to property is legal written proof of ownership. |
